More Information We are A fraternal order with more than 750,000 members and a 150+ year history A network of nearly 2000 lodges in communities all over the country A generous charitable foundation that each year gives millions in scholarships, an inspiration to youth, a friend to veterans and more Our Mission To inculcate the principles of Charity, Justice, Brotherly Love and Fidelity

Elks Care, Elks Share Are YOU an Elk? Elks Lodges bring so much more to their communities than just a building, golf course or pool They are places where neighbors come together, families share meals, and children grow up Elks invest in their communities through programs that help children grow up healthy and drug-free, meet the needs of today's veterans, and improve the quality of life
